aww what a sweet heart!! you'll get somemore info but, i dampen a half microfiber towel then spray with my colloidal silver and wipe his face wrinkles and chops after he eats... . does the trick for us.
@Bellathebulldog2 I also use fragrance free baby wipe. The trick is to keep it dry. Basically the whole face dry.
I use a microfiber cloth as well after eating and drinking. If needed, I’ll use a Duoxo medicated wipe as well.
